    Well that is with the internet speed test which tends to change even with a wired connection, that is just a test for your ISP connection speed which will be a little slower than the wired speed test. That isn't the one I check for wireless speed.

    The reported speed I'm talking about is the LAN speed which is showing up as 300Mbps. You can see this on iinsidder and in Windows when you check the wireless status.
